Timezone in Bukit Pinang

Bukit Pinang is located in Malaysia and follows the Asia/Kuala_Lumpur timezone, which has a UTC offset of +8 hours. Malaysia does not observe daylight saving time, so the UTC offset remains constant throughout the year. This means that the time in Bukit Pinang does not change seasonally, simplifying scheduling for residents and visitors alike.
